Preheat oven to 400°F.
In a small skillet, cook bacon until almost crisp. Using a slotted spoon, remove from skillet to a paper towel-lined plate. Set aside.
Place butter, shallots, bell pepper, celery, lemon juice, Worcestershire sauce and cayenne pepper in a food processor. Pulse until well combined, about 20 seconds.
Spread 1/4 inch rock salt on a rimmed baking sheet.
Place sheet in oven and bake for 8 minutes.
Place oysters firmly in the hot rock salt. Be careful not to burn yourself and not to spill the juice from the shells.
Place 1 tablespoon of the butter mixture on each oyster.
Top each with a sprinkling of bacon.
Place sheet back in oven and bake oysters until bubbly, about 12 minutes. Do not overcook.
Sprinkle with parsley and serve immediately.
